Thanksgiving and Gratitude

Thanksgiving Day is a tradition celebrated annually on the fourth Thursday in November. Your children may enjoy learning about Thanksgiving history and traditional activities. The tradition traces its origins to a harvest feast and celebration of thanksgiving held by the pilgrim settlers of the Plymouth Plantation in 1621. They survived their first season with help from Squanto, a Wampanoag Indian who taught them to catch eel and grow corn, and from Massassoit, the Wampanoag tribal leader who donated food to the colony when their initial stores were insufficient.

Christmas and Gift Giving

Christmas Day is a Christian holiday observed annually on December 25 to commemorate the birth of Jesus. Christmas celebrations often include traditions from various winter solstice festivals and folklore such as the story of Santa Claus. You might consider how to answer the Santa question.

Holiday Printables for Thanksgiving, Christmas, and Hanukkah

ColoringPages24.com will publish a new holiday coloring page every day from November 21 thru Christmas.

AtoZTeacherStuff.com provides Christmas activities, color pages, shapebooks, word searches, border pages, wish lists, and countdown calendars, which could all work well for use in holiday lapbooks. To find the free Christmas printables on A to Z Teacher Stuff:

  1. Click on the Printables tab.
  2. In the side menu, find "Theme-Related."
  3. Click "Christmas."

Related themes include "Winter" and "Pumpkins." Find "Thanksgiving" in the main list. The first couple of items in each area tend to point to store items, but the majority of items in each list are usually free.

ABCTeach.com provides a selection of free theme units including pilgrims, pumpkins, scarecrows, and Native Americans, as well as a whole section of Thanksgiving activity sheets and coloring pages, including cross words, shape books, book report forms, spelling lists, word searches, signs, and writing prompts.

ABC Teach also provides a large Christmas section with a variety of activity sheets and coloring pages, including Polar Express theme pages, mazes, writing prompts, scrambled words, and stories. Coloring pages include Christian and secular images (angels, baby Jesus, Advent wreaths and candles, bells, trees, ornaments, wise men, etc.)

ColoringCastle.com provides a selection of large, simple printable coloring pages, including sections on Thanksgiving, Christmas, and Hanukkah.
